Selebi-Phikwe schools do well in JC exams
Friday, January 08, 2010
Junior Secondary Schools (JSS) located in this town are always in the top 10 when Junior Certificate (JC) results are released. Speaking to Mmegi in an interview, Meepong Junior Secondary School headmaster, Sechaba Oabile, said they have done exceptionally well and they have improved from the 2008 results. He mentioned that in quantity they got 99.5 percent making them the best in the country and quality they managed to get 59.9 percent.
"The school got 12 A's, 97 B's, 72 C's and 1 D. This is an improvement from last year and it is a great motivation for us as the school. We managed to achieve these results due to the support we got from different stakeholders such as the Department of Secondary Education in terms of funding and conducting workshops for teachers to improve their performance," he said. Oabile said parents are also playing a huge role in the education of their children because they attend meetings when invited.
